Leone Star Player declare unfit to be replaced

The medical team of the Leone Stars has discovered that one of the players, Alhassan
Koroma has been declared unfit for the tournament. Alhassan is said to suffer from an hamstring injury.
As an alternative, the Technical staff of National Football Association, Leone Stars, has requested for Augustine Kargbo to join the squad to participate in the Africa Cup of Nations tournament in Cameroun which is scheduled to kick off on 9 January 2022.
Augustine Kargbo was one of the players recently placed on the standby list by the technical staff in the event of a possible replacement in the selected 28- man squad to the AFCON tournament.
